This is Pakkirappa Hunagundi. He's a 30 year-old village labourer from Karnataka, western India. And that's a brick.

Hunagundi says he's been eating up to three kilos of bricks, gravel and mud every day for the last 20 years.

He generally finds material to eat lying around his village. But, say his neighbours, "he relishes hot charcoal, too, like a snack."

"We feel very bad. We have tried to convince him many times [to stop], but he does not listen. We have given up now."
